In our daily lives, we tend to face challenges that can result in feelings of pressure. During these tough times, it's crucial to offer ourselves with the same compassion we would offer to a friend. Self-compassion involves approaching ourselves with tenderness, accepting our difficulties without condemnation.

Cultivating self-compassion can transform your view with yourself. It allows you to become more forgiving towards your shortcomings, and it develops your capacity to handle adversity.

Through practicing self-compassion, you can foster a stronger sense of peace in your life.
